FULTON, Miss. - The Lady Indians (10-7-0, 5-3-0 MACJC North) wrapped up the regular season with 9-0 win over Southwest Tennessee Community College (0-10-0) to set the mark for most wins (10) in a single season on Sophomore Day.
Morgan Dennis (Saltillo) had a pair of goals and an assist in the win. Allie Barnett (Iuka) had two goals while Malarie Scott (Saltillo) added a goal and assist. Francisca Galleguillos-Pollarolo (Santiago Nunoa, Chile), Audrey Wilson (Starkville), Addison Meadows (Oxford), and Deanna Christie (Liverpool, England) each added a goal for the Lady Indians.
Merrie Kate Grayson (Tupelo) and Haley McGill (Saltillo) each had a pair of saves to combine for their eighth shutout of the season.
The Lady Indians will host Mississippi Gulf Coast Community College (6-5-2, 3-3-2 MACJC South) in a rematch from last season's quarterfinals at 12:00 p.m. after finishing second place in the North Division. The event will mark the first time in the program's history that the Lady Indians have hosted a home playoff match.
